Market Size and Forecast
The United States Cider Market was valued at approximately USD 1.21 Billion in 2025 and is projected to expand at a CAGR of 3.4% during 2026–2035. By 2035, the market is forecast to reach approximately USD 1.69 Billion. This trajectory represents a measured growth outlook supported by continuing product development and changing preferences within the cider category. Competitive Landscape
The competitive landscape of the United States Cider Market includes major beverage organizations and specialist cider businesses with different approaches to product development, branding, distribution, and regional presence. Companies covered by Expert Market Research include Heineken N.V., Carlsberg Group, ANHEUSER-BUSCH INBEV SA/NV, Asahi Group Holdings, Ltd., C & C Group plc, Molson Coors Beverage Company, Boston Beer Corporation, Angry Orchard Cider Company, LLC, Blake’s Family of Companies, Austin Eastciders, Inc., and Others. Competition is shaped by portfolio breadth, packaging capabilities, distribution reach, and the ability to respond to evolving consumer preferences.
